Stepper motricium cum planetarium Gearbox Key components:

Stepper Motors:

  • A Brushless DC motricium quod movet in discretus vestigia, offering precise positioning et celeritate imperium.
  • Communiter in bipolar vel unipolar configurations.
  • Vestigia per revolution: typically CC gradus (1.8 ° per gradus), sed microstpping potest providere pulchrior resolutio.
 

Planetarium Gearboxes:

  • A calces reducer solis calces, planeta annulum et circulum calces providing excelsum torque output in pacto consilio.
  • Notum enim princeps efficientiam, onus distribution et humilis backlash.
  • Ratio: Communiter range ex III, I ad CCXVI: I.
 

Quid est operatur?:

  • Sepperit motor agit solis calces planetarum Gearbox.
  • Planeta Gears Rotate circum sole calces et reticulum cum stabilem anulus calces.
  • Hoc eventus in reductionem motricium scriptor output celeritate dum augendae torque.
 

Commoda:

  • High Torque output: planetarium Gearboxes amplio motricium scriptor torque significantly.
  • Pacto consilium: Gearbox est integrated directe motor, salvo spatio.
  • Motion Imperium: Stepper Motors Providere accurate positioning, praesertim cum microstpping.
  • Minimum backlash: Planetarium Gearboxes habere minimal backlash, cursus praecise motus.
  • Diuturnitatem: robust consilio ad altus-onus applications.
